タグ

フレームワークに関するchess-newsのブックマーク (23)

  • ビジネスの地図を描こう | Bizmap(ビズマップ)

    BizMakeサービス終了に関するお知らせ 平素より「BizMake」をご利用いただきましてありがとうございます。 誠に勝手ではございますが、2023年6月30日(金)をもちまして、BizMakeのサービス 提供を終了させていただくこととなりました。 これまで長らくBizMakeをご愛顧いただき、誠にありがとうございました。お客様には 大変ご迷惑をおかけし、心よりお詫び申し上げます。 【お問い合わせ】 サービス終了に関するご質問やお問い合わせがございましたら、以下のURLよりお問い 合わせください。 https://www.tsh-world.co.jp/inquiry/otherproduct/ 改めまして、BizMakeをご利用いただいたすべてのお客様に、心より感謝申し上げます。 東京システムハウス株式会社 質問 回答 サービス終了の理由は何ですか? 事業整理、リソースの集中をするため

  • Cynefin framework - Wikipedia

    The Cynefin Framework as revised The Cynefin framework (/kəˈnɛvɪn/ kuh-NEV-in)[1] is a conceptual framework used to aid decision-making.[2] Created in 1999 by Dave Snowden when he worked for IBM Global Services, it has been described as a "sense-making device".[3][4] Cynefin is a Welsh word for 'habitat'.[5] Cynefin offers five decision-making contexts or "domains"—clear (known as simple until 201

    Cynefin framework - Wikipedia
  • 🗂️ Design Materials:この状況にどのように対応すればいい?さまざまな状況を理解して、適切な対応を選択しよう。クネビン・フレームワーク|noko|note

    🗂️ Design Materials:この状況にどのように対応すればいい?さまざまな状況を理解して、適切な対応を選択しよう。クネビン・フレームワーク 「クネビン・フレームワーク」とは?通常、状況または問題領域が異なれば、必要な対応も異なります。 クネビンフレームワークは、答えが定かではない問題へのアプローチを分類することができるフレームワークで目の前の状況を理解し、対処している状況のタイプに適した決定を下すのに役立ちます。 💡クネビン(Cynefin)フレームワークとは、IBMのデイビッド・スノーデンが1999年に開発した問題解決のフレームワークです。クネビン は、ウェールズ語で、生息地という意味です。因果関係が明確、また正解が明確でなく難しい状況でベストプラクティスが使えない問題においてもどうやって取り組んでいくべきかというのを考えることができます。 💡ストプラクティスとは、ある

    🗂️ Design Materials:この状況にどのように対応すればいい?さまざまな状況を理解して、適切な対応を選択しよう。クネビン・フレームワーク|noko|note
  • 問題の解決アプローチを見極める『クネビンフレームワーク』をざっくりまとめる - コード日進月歩

    問題に対して因果関係に重きをおいて分類するフレームワーク、クネビンフレームワークをまとめる 「クネビン(カネヴィン)フレームワーク(Cynefin Framework)」とは 問題の種類を因果関係、秩序だったものか、突発できであるかなどの観点から捉えて分類し、どのように解決すべきかのアプローチをまとめたもの。図に表すと下記の通り。 Cynefin framework - Wikipedia を元にしたクネビンフレームワークの図 名称 説明とプラクティスの種類 単純 因果関係が単純な誰にでも解がわかる問題、ベストプラクティスが適用できる 困難 因果関係が複雑で解が複数あるような問題、専門家による分析でベストではない最適な解、グッドプラクティスを得ることができるような問題 複雑 分析だけでは到底解が出ない問題。繰り返し調査をしたりしながら問題を感知して解としてプラクティスを導き出す。 カオス

    問題の解決アプローチを見極める『クネビンフレームワーク』をざっくりまとめる - コード日進月歩
  • Webアプリケーションフレームワーク導入時に考慮すべき22の観点 - Qiita

    記事では、 チームによる持続的に変更可能なWebアプリケーションの開発を目標に、フレームワーク導入時に考慮すべき22の観点を紹介する。 フレームワークによって特徴は異なるが、番導入にあたって、考慮すべきポイントはあまり変わらないので、極力フレームワーク1に依存しすぎないよう配慮する。また、話をシンプルにするため、REST APIを提供するアプリケーションを題材とする。 前提 ソフトウェアのエントロピー ソフトウェアがエントロピー増大の法則を避けられないことを、体感している開発者は多いだろう2。普通にアプリケーション開発を続けると、開発スピードは鈍化し、品質は低下してバグが増え、開発者からは技術的負債への怨嗟の声が聞かれるようになる。エントロピー増大というフォースは極めて強力で、意思を持って立ち向かわなければ、容易にダークサイドに堕ちてしまう。 関心事の分離 大規模Webアプリケーション

    Webアプリケーションフレームワーク導入時に考慮すべき22の観点 - Qiita
  • Rubyist Magazine - スはスペックのス 【第 1 回】 RSpec の概要と、RSpec on Rails (モデル編)

    『るびま』は、Ruby に関する技術記事はもちろんのこと、Rubyist へのインタビューやエッセイ、その他をお届けするウェブ雑誌です。 Rubyist Magazine について 『Rubyist Magazine』、略して『るびま』は、Rubyist の Rubyist による、Rubyist とそうでない人のためのウェブ雑誌です。 最新号 Rubyist Magazine 0062 号 バックナンバー Rubyist Magazine 0062 号 Kaigi on Rails 特集号 RubyKaigi Takeout 2020 特集号 Rubyist Magazine 0061 号 Rubyist Magazine 0060 号 RubyKaigi 2019 直前特集号 Rubyist Magazine 0059 号 Rubyist Magazine 0058 号 RubyKai

    Rubyist Magazine - スはスペックのス 【第 1 回】 RSpec の概要と、RSpec on Rails (モデル編)
  • Javaのマイクロフレームワーク ― この新トレンドは見逃せない | POSTD

    この記事は、JavaScalaの例外分析・パフォーマンス監視のツール Takapiblog に投稿されたものです。 Javaのマイクロフレームワークとは何か、推奨される理由とは? どんなプログラミング言語にも、長所と短所はあるものです。例えばJavaは、安全性の高さや、厳しいテストを経ていること、後方互換性などの利点を持つ言語です。しかし、その代償として、アジリティ(俊敏性)や合理性といった面が少なからず犠牲になっています。冗長で、Java自体が肥大化しているという事実も否定できません。とはいえ、新規開発や大規模な開発を行いたい場合、JVM(Java仮想マシン)はバックエンドとして非常に魅力的です。JVMはパワフルな上に、非常に厳しい環境でテストされています。このような利点があるため、結果的にJavaは広く使用され、積極的にデプロイされているのです。 しかし、このJavaの現状を皆

    Javaのマイクロフレームワーク ― この新トレンドは見逃せない | POSTD
  • Javaを使うなら知っておきたい技術、フレームワーク、ライブラリ、ツールまとめ

    Javaの開発と言っても、各種ミドルウェアやフレームワーク、ライブラリ、ツールなどが豊富にあり選択に悩むことは少なくないと思います。 そこで関連技術のインデックスになればと作成しました。 あくまで知っている範囲で記述しているので、コメントしてもらえれば随時追加します! すべてを書くと膨大な量になるため、現状採用が減ってきているものや、そもそもあまり採用されていないもの、後継があったり、類似のものと比較した場合に明らかに劣っているものは省いています。 ちなみにライブラリには高機能なものも多いので、分類は参考程度にご覧下さい。 サーバ系 Apache HTTP Server 世界中でもっとも多く使われているWebサーバ。 nginx フリーかつオープンソースのWebサーバで、処理性能・高い並行性・メモリ使用量の小ささに焦点を当てて開発されている。 Tomcat Java ServletやJSP

    Javaを使うなら知っておきたい技術、フレームワーク、ライブラリ、ツールまとめ
  • Spring Framework - Wikipedia

    Spring Framework は、Javaプラットフォーム向けのオープンソースアプリケーションフレームワークである。単に Spring とも呼ばれる。ロッド・ジョンソン(英語版)が自著 Expert One-on-One J2EE Design and Development(Wrox Press、2002年10月)と共にリリースしたのが最初である。.NET Framework 向けの移植版もある[2]。2006年、Spring Framework 1.2.6 は Jolt productivity award を受賞した[3]。 Spring Framework は特定のプログラミングモデルを強制するものではないが、Javaコミュニティでは Enterprise JavaBeans (EJB) モデルの代替・置換・追加として広く認知されつつある。設計上、このフレームワークはJava

  • 振り返り6ツール比較!! 〜YWTとKPTとPDCAの違い(あとLAMDAとか経験学習モデルとか)〜 - ざっくんのブログ

    こんにちは。ざっくんです。 最近は記事の更新頻度がめっきり少なくなっていました。その辺の、習慣化なのか自制・意志の強さなのかとかの振り返りはまた今度記事にするとして。 今回は前々からまとめようと思っていた「振り返りツール」的な奴らの話をしたいと思います。いろんな種類があって、どれがいいの?とかってなることが多いと思うので自分の中の整理も兼ねて。 この記事の要約 ◆それぞれのツールをいい感じにまとめるとこんな感じ 概要 思考(実行)の流れとの対応 ◆「こんな時はこれを使え!」ってやつははっきり言ってない。目的に合わせてカスタマイズして使うといいと思う。ただまぁ一応、オススメの使い方はこんな感じ。 毎日の個人の振り返り:YWT+経験学習モデル+α イベントの運営振り返り:YWTかKPT イベントでの参加者の学びを深める振り返り:経験学習モデル+グラフィックハーベスティング チームの改善:KPT

    振り返り6ツール比較!! 〜YWTとKPTとPDCAの違い(あとLAMDAとか経験学習モデルとか)〜 - ざっくんのブログ
  • DRBFMとは|用語集|株式会社ITID

    Design Review Based on Failure Modeの略。 トヨタ自動車によって確立された体系的なFMEAの運用方法。一般的な運用と異なり、DRBFMは設計の変更点に着目するのが特徴。設計変更による影響を徹底的に議論し尽くしてから設計審査を実施する、という同社のGD3(Good Design, Good Discussion, Good Design Review)の考え方に基づいている。 DRBFMは設計変更点を起点として分析するため、従来のFMEAと比べて効率良く問題の未然防止活動を実施することができる。ただし、従来の設計で高い信頼性が確保されていることが前提条件になるため、結局は継続的な技術の蓄積が重要になる。 ITIDでは「開発の見える化ソリューション」のフレームワークのひとつ「判断の見える化」がDRBFMに該当する。同時に「技術の見える化」によって技術を見える化

  • 決定分析(DA表)とは 意思決定のためのKT法(その4) - ものづくりドットコム

    【目次】 1、KT法とは 2、状況分析 3、問題分析 4、決定分析 ← 今回の解説 5、潜在的問題(リスク)分析 ◆DA表とは KT法における決定分析(DA)は、どんな条件で目標を達成しようとしているかを明確化させることが重要です。条件をMUSTとWANT条件で区別し、さらに目標値の重み付けを行い、競争に勝てる案を選択する必要があります。「なるほど」と膝を打てる案を選択できなくてはならないのです。その案が決定したら、さらに実行案のリスクを評価する必要があります。そのためには、潜在的問題分析(PPA)も必要になる場合が多いようです。その際は、予防対策や緊急時対策も必要に応じて設定しておくと良いと思います。 ここでは、事例として意識的にやや古い機種に限定して、インクジェットプリンター購入時における評価を表1に取り上げてみました。最近の比較は、みなさんが購入されるときに実施してください。 表1 

    決定分析(DA表)とは 意思決定のためのKT法(その4) - ものづくりドットコム
  • MECEとは?デキるビジネスは知っているスキルを全力で解説してみた【MECE完全版】 | 考えるを考えるメディア

    Pocket 突然だが、あなたは話をしていて「言ってることがよくわからない」と相手に言われたことがあるのではないだろうか?一生懸命伝えようとしてるのにも関わらず、なぜ話が上手く伝わらないのだろうか。 物事を過不足なく相手に伝えるには、自分の頭の中をしっかり整理しなければいけない。 頭の中を整理するには、どうすればいいのか? その謎を、MECEという概念を交えて解きほぐしていこう。 MECEは、ビジネスマンとしての付加価値をつけるスキル 先に、MECEとは何か簡単に言っておくと、「フレームワーク」といわれる「型」であり、物事を「もれなく、ダブりなく」整理する技術だ。ビジネスパーソンであれば研修等で一度は聞かされる単語だろう。ではなぜMECEをわざわざ研修を行って習得させるのか。MECEを習得する意義として、ビジネスパーソンとしての付加価値を見出せるという理由が大きい。 例えばMECEを習得す

    MECEとは?デキるビジネスは知っているスキルを全力で解説してみた【MECE完全版】 | 考えるを考えるメディア
  • Redmine Backlogsではじめてのスクラム | Scimpr Blog

    スクラムとはScrum(スクラム)は、アジャイル開発の手法の1つ. 欧米では、「おれ、こうやったらうまく行ったんだけど、みんな、こうやったらいいよ?」っていう仕組みをフレームワークというんだけど、スクラムもその意味でのアジャイル開発の中のフレームワークの1つだと思う. 「かんばん!かんばん!~もし女子高生がRedmineスクラム開発をしたら」でまとめられていたスクラムを100字で表すと スクラムアジャイルプロセスの1つで、高いビジネス価値をより早期に顧客に提供することを可能にするスクラムは動作するソフトウェアを速やかに繰り返し確認していく(2週間~1カ月周期で)顧客は要件の優先順位をつける。チームは優先度の高い機能を顧客に納める最良の方法を自分たちで決定する2週間~1カ月ごとに動作するソフトウェアをみることができ、そのままリリースするか、別のスプリントで機能拡張するかを決めることができ

    Redmine Backlogsではじめてのスクラム | Scimpr Blog
  • 図解と事例でわかるビジネス問題解決フレームワーク20選

    「研修やでビジネスフレームワークを学んでみましたが、ぶっちゃけビジネスフレームワークって何かよく分かりません!」 これは私が上司としてマネジメントする中で、よく部下から受ける相談です。 正直、中堅の社員でもビジネスフレームワークを使いこなして仕事ができているビジネスマンはそう多くはありません。 ただ、私の長いマネジメント経験から、ビジネスフレームワークを使いこなせるようになった方が良いと考えます。使いこなせるようになることで、下記3点のメリットがあります。 仕事が5倍速くなる上司にもクライアントにも”わかりやすい資料”が作れる自分の頭を整理できるこのページでは「今日から使える」をテーマに、ビジネスフレームワークの質的な使い方と具体的なフレームワーク20個を下記の流れでご紹介します。 あなたが身につけるべきビジネスフレームワークとは状況を分析するフレームワーク8選戦略を構築するためのフレ

  • ROS(Robot Operating System)概論

    ロボットの話題を聞くことが増えたが、判断と制御、駆動を備えたロボットを作るのはかなり骨が折れる。その負担を軽減するフレームワークが「ROS」(Robot Operating System)だ。その概論を説明する。

    ROS(Robot Operating System)概論
  • IT業界の裏話: ビジネスの実践でよくつかう問題解決のフレームワーク<基本6個+問題発見12個>

    最近、フレームワークに関するブログエントリーを多く見かけます。 フレームワークを日語に直訳すると「枠組み」という意味であり、型にはめて何かをやる際に使われる言葉として日常的に浸透しています。毎日同じ作業をやっていると、自然に自分なりのやり方が定まってくると思いますが、これだってフレームワークのひとつです。 そう考えると、世の中はフレームワークで満ち溢れていることになります。あなたが朝起きてから家を出るまでの一連の流れだって、日々の経験によって効率化されたフレームワークなのです。 フレームワークを仕事の中でうまく使えるようになると仕事を効率化してくれます。その結果、来かかったであろう時間を短縮することができ、その分の時間を別のことに使えるようになるという効果が期待できます。また、相手が知っているフレームワークを使って議論を整理したり資料を作ると、相手の理解を得るのも早くなります。 コメン

    IT業界の裏話: ビジネスの実践でよくつかう問題解決のフレームワーク<基本6個+問題発見12個>
    chess-news
    chess-news 2015/04/22
     まあ、ベタですが。
  • ssig33.com - よく分からない人のためのセキュリティ

    いろいろと原則論はあるんですが。昨今のアプリケーションは複雑化し、扱う情報はよりセンシティブになり、そしてより幅広く使われるようになっています。よって「安全な」アプリケーションを作るために必要な知識はますます増える傾向にあります。 よく分かってない人は以下のことにとりあえず気をつけましょう 1. なるべく自分で作らない これは最も重要なことです。検索する、他人に聞く、自分で考えない。これは重要です。大抵の問題は他人が作ってくれた解決策を適用できます。 例えばセキュアな問合せフォームを作ることにしましょう。気をつけるべきことは以下のことぐらいでしょうか。 送信内容の確認画面を表示する場合、ユーザーの入力した値は適切にエスケープするように 送信内容をアプリケーションの DB に格納する場合には SQL インジェクションを防がなければならないので、プリペアドステートメントを用いる CSRF 対策

  • 第1回 Hubotとは何か | gihyo.jp

    連載では、GitHub社が開発したチャットbot開発・実行フレームワークである「Hubot」を使用して、チャットツールにオリジナルのbotを住まわせ、開発フローに組み込むことで開発を楽にする方法について解説していきます。 botとはなにか 開発の現場で、開発チーム内のコミュニケーションのためにIRCなどのチャットツールを導入することは、よく見る光景だと思います。そんなチャットツールに常駐してチャット経由でコマンドを待ち受けて実行したり、決められた条件に従ってチャットに発言してチャットの参加者に通知したりするようなプログラムのことをbotと呼びます。 Skype、HipChatやChatWorkなどコミュニケーションツールが多様化した現代においても、それぞれのチャットツールに対応したbotが開発されており、botを開発するためのフレームワークも様々な形で提供されています。botを導入するこ

    第1回 Hubotとは何か | gihyo.jp
  • Webの仕事をするなら最低限知っておくべき戦略フレームワーク×10 | sogitani.baigie.blog

    経営やマーケティング、ブランディングなど、ビジネスを語る際に必要な論理的思考。その思考パターンを定型化し、誰でも使えるようにしたのが戦略フレームワークです。戦略フレームワークはビジネスのあらゆる分野で使われており、有名・無名を含めると、膨大な数が存在します。 戦略フレームワークを使うと、現状を論理的に構造化し、客観的に俯瞰できるようになります。また、いつもフレームワーク発想で考えるクセを付けていると、ヒアリングしたその場で企業が抱える問題点が見えてきたり、自分の主張や提案を、分かりやすく説得力をともなって伝えることができるようにもなります。 Web業界はテクノロジーの影響が非常に強い業界です。特に制作や開発に深く関わる業種・職種ほど、ビジネスの質ではなく、技術的なトレンドに流された発想に陥りがちです。 しかし、戦略フレームワークの考えをマスターしていれば、技術トレンドに流されず、ビジネス

    Webの仕事をするなら最低限知っておくべき戦略フレームワーク×10 | sogitani.baigie.blog